Package | Description |
---|---|
org.apache.hadoop.hbase.io.encoding |
Modifier and Type | Class and Description |
---|---|
class |
HFileBlockDefaultEncodingContext
A default implementation of
HFileBlockEncodingContext . |
Modifier and Type | Method and Description |
---|---|
HFileBlockEncodingContext |
AbstractDataBlockEncoder.newDataBlockEncodingContext(DataBlockEncoding encoding,
byte[] header,
HFileContext meta) |
HFileBlockEncodingContext |
DataBlockEncoder.newDataBlockEncodingContext(DataBlockEncoding encoding,
byte[] headerBytes,
HFileContext meta)
Creates a encoder specific encoding context
|
Modifier and Type | Method and Description |
---|---|
int |
RowIndexCodecV1.encode(Cell cell,
HFileBlockEncodingContext encodingCtx,
DataOutputStream out) |
int |
DataBlockEncoder.encode(Cell cell,
HFileBlockEncodingContext encodingCtx,
DataOutputStream out)
Encodes a KeyValue.
|
void |
RowIndexCodecV1.endBlockEncoding(HFileBlockEncodingContext encodingCtx,
DataOutputStream out,
byte[] uncompressedBytesWithHeader) |
void |
DataBlockEncoder.endBlockEncoding(HFileBlockEncodingContext encodingCtx,
DataOutputStream out,
byte[] uncompressedBytesWithHeader)
Ends encoding for a block of KeyValues.
|
protected void |
AbstractDataBlockEncoder.postEncoding(HFileBlockEncodingContext encodingCtx) |
void |
CopyKeyDataBlockEncoder.startBlockEncoding(HFileBlockEncodingContext blkEncodingCtx,
DataOutputStream out) |
void |
RowIndexCodecV1.startBlockEncoding(HFileBlockEncodingContext blkEncodingCtx,
DataOutputStream out) |
void |
DataBlockEncoder.startBlockEncoding(HFileBlockEncodingContext encodingCtx,
DataOutputStream out)
Starts encoding for a block of KeyValues.
|
Copyright © 2007–2019 The Apache Software Foundation. All rights reserved.